Stray Shots From Solomon is a book written by S. Davidson and published in 1907. The book is a collection of short essays and musings on various topics, all inspired by the wisdom of King Solomon from the Old Testament. The author draws from Solomon's proverbs and teachings to offer insights on subjects such as love, friendship, work, and faith. The book is written in a straightforward and accessible style, making it easy for readers to understand and apply the lessons to their own lives.
